| Classification | Hazel | |
| Height: | up to 20 m | |
| Leaf: | ovate | |
| Bloom: | February / March, male catkins, up to 12 cm long, female bloom is inconspicuous, red | |
| Fruit: | nut, edible | |
| Branches: | young shoots with glandular hair | |
| Bark: | grayish brown, shallow furrows | |
| Root: | roots in the shape of a heart | |
| Location: | sun to half-shade | |
| Soil: | sandy to loamy | |
| ph-value: | slightly acidic to very basic | |
